    The heal scales of your max health, and is really strong for tanks with a lot of health (also grands minor protection and major resolve). So it really depends on what you play (I dueled some magblade who used it and he wrecked me, not that I am good in pvp so :shrug:)

    The heal kinda sucks to be honest. Magblades can do well in duels because you can stack it up with multiple hots and lots of mitigation, but there's still no burst heal for the class so in open world or BGs if you get a spike of damage coming in from multiple people you dont have many options.

    Let me put it this way; Dark Cloak isn't a bad skill, it's actually an alright skill, it's just that Shadowy Disguise is one of the best skills in the game.

    With the press of one button you...
    1. Deny your opponent knowledge of your positioning (element of surprise like no other)
    2. Engage OR disengage AT WILL into any fight you like or don't like.
    3. Suppress all DoT damage, while HoTs continue to tick.
    4. Automatically "dodge" any attack currently in-flight on mid-animation, negating it's damage completely
    5. Grant yourself a guaranteed crit on your next attack, to be used at your discretion on your most damaging attack, including ults.
    6. Trigger any number of proc sets that require being in or attacking from stealth, something which was previously only possible once per engagement.

    It is simultaneously the single most powerful offensive AND defensive skill in the entire game.

    As an aside, it's also responsible for the state NB was in before (as brokenly OP) and now (as nerfed as they are) because you inherently cannot balance on-demand invisibility in a game like this, nevermind one that also comes with bonuses like free crits and DoT suppression.
